Commit Graph

  • 721702fce4 cli/gtk: move GTK-specific code to a new file in a subdirectory Jeffrey C. Ollie 2025-07-11 09:59:14 -05:00
  • 340d190bf0 cli/gtk: clarify +new-window documentation and improve instance discovery Jeffrey C. Ollie 2025-07-10 12:11:01 -05:00
  • 7845399c00 cli/gtk: add +new-window action Jeffrey C. Ollie 2025-07-09 23:05:15 -05:00
  • ca5e361977 macos: restore tabs correctly into a single window (#7942) Mitchell Hashimoto 2025-07-14 11:31:52 -07:00
  • 02b08e0ec9 macos: restore tabs correctly into a single window Mitchell Hashimoto 2025-07-14 11:22:33 -07:00
  • 02069a54c4 gtk: improve error handling and memory management for OpenURI Jeffrey C. Ollie 2025-07-14 11:41:03 -05:00
  • f86a9f60f9 gtk: open non-file URLs using the XDG Desktop Portal Jeffrey C. Ollie 2025-07-08 21:35:39 -05:00
  • 37c2c3a4ba build: update libxev to remove usingnamespace usage (#7935) Mitchell Hashimoto 2025-07-13 21:50:32 -07:00
  • 355c8a4d16 build: update libxev to remove usingnamespace usage Mitchell Hashimoto 2025-07-13 21:34:15 -07:00
  • a40c2c3c16 build(deps): bump cachix/install-nix-action from 31.5.0 to 31.5.1 (#7933) Mitchell Hashimoto 2025-07-13 21:22:33 -07:00
  • ddcb1ce8fb build(deps): bump namespacelabs/nscloud-cache-action dependabot[bot] 2025-07-14 00:56:40 +00:00
  • 1a826a1e51 build(deps): bump cachix/install-nix-action from 31.5.0 to 31.5.1 dependabot[bot] 2025-07-14 00:55:26 +00:00
  • 532d93d1b3 capture inside of switch, and check if it is empty for some reason rhodes-b 2025-07-13 19:40:07 -05:00
  • d6d6e4d94b set title as argv[0] for commands specified with -e rhodes-b 2025-07-13 19:21:30 -05:00
  • 1c0677faab nix: fix flake input (#7924) Mitchell Hashimoto 2025-07-13 14:09:40 -07:00
  • cdfec43b66 Update iTerm2 colorschemes (#7926) Mitchell Hashimoto 2025-07-13 14:09:30 -07:00
  • b43fa129d6 deps: Update iTerm2 color schemes mitchellh 2025-07-13 00:15:37 +00:00
  • c61e36b035 nix: use rev instead of ref for flake inputs Naïm Camille Favier 2025-07-13 00:40:19 +02:00
  • ad3f837b36 nix: fix flake input Naïm Camille Favier 2025-07-12 20:01:20 +02:00
  • d9839dbae5 macos: add titled-visible-menu option to macos-non-native-fullscreen Sassan Haradji 2025-01-27 19:28:44 +04:00
  • 11ba929d5d removed boolean logic, reverted back to ctrlOrSuper call Alex 2025-07-12 10:03:43 -07:00
  • e19d438479 Removed boolean logic, reverted back to ctrlOrSuper call Alex 2025-07-12 09:29:03 -07:00
  • fb0040b65e Merge branch 'fix-copy-url' into fix-copy-url-minimal Remove boolean logic as it is not needed, revert back to using ctrlOrSuper call in linkAtPos Alex 2025-07-12 09:39:34 -07:00
  • 06fcbd6378 fix: make regular URLs work with either ctrl or super modifiers Alex Straight 2025-06-08 23:08:11 -07:00
  • 5e8ce20e71 fix: copy_url_to_clipboard copies full OSC8 URL instead of single character Alex Straight 2025-06-08 21:53:28 -07:00
  • 34aa98ab94 Merge branch 'main' into fix-copy-url Alex 2025-07-12 09:30:45 -07:00
  • fc48354b36 remove commented out block Alex 2025-07-12 09:30:01 -07:00
  • a19f4aea0a Removed boolean logic, reverted back to ctrlOrSuper call Alex 2025-07-12 09:29:03 -07:00
  • b5000dcd94 fix webdata build, run it in CI (#7921) Mitchell Hashimoto 2025-07-12 07:03:08 -07:00
  • 658567bbbd fix webdata build, run it in CI Mitchell Hashimoto 2025-07-12 06:45:52 -07:00
  • eb9e6614e5 Add new translations for Dutch Merijntje Tak 2025-07-12 08:54:25 +02:00
  • cbdaceb1cb Merge remote-tracking branch 'upstream/main' Merijntje Tak 2025-07-12 08:52:42 +02:00
  • f904209278 Use unrounded cell_width to calculate icon_width Daniel Wennberg 2025-07-11 22:16:30 -07:00
  • beaf665ea9 Update to imperative Merijntje Tak 2025-07-12 06:54:50 +02:00
  • e67a62453d core/gtk: add apprt action to show native GUI warning when child exits (#7836) Jeffrey C. Ollie 2025-07-11 23:14:18 -05:00
  • 5a5e0df574 i18n: update translations Jeffrey C. Ollie 2025-07-11 22:57:17 -05:00
  • 1abc3ba1da gtk: change child exited verbiage to be clearer and code cleanup Jeffrey C. Ollie 2025-07-08 14:28:38 -05:00
  • 9ee25e8a69 gtk: use close button in show_child_exited banner Jeffrey C. Ollie 2025-07-08 12:19:41 -05:00
  • 8cea111329 gtk: add some comments for show_child_exited Jeffrey C. Ollie 2025-07-08 12:19:12 -05:00
  • 49243db4b3 gtk: GtkBox not needed for show_child_exited Jeffrey C. Ollie 2025-07-08 12:17:49 -05:00
  • 7fd900647e show_child_exited: remove emojis Jeffrey C. Ollie 2025-07-08 09:52:57 -05:00
  • f24ec13963 remove unused css class from gtk child exited widget Jeffrey C. Ollie 2025-07-07 11:59:03 -05:00
  • bf0659f07b use checkmark for icon if child exits normally Jeffrey C. Ollie 2025-07-07 11:52:13 -05:00
  • 3d89a68fff fix error set for function return signature Jeffrey C. Ollie 2025-07-07 11:48:08 -05:00
  • 28c7083876 gtk show_child_edit: use different text for normal/abnormal exit Jeffrey C. Ollie 2025-07-06 16:54:34 -05:00
  • 5219bc51e5 show child exited: return a boolean if native GUI is shown Jeffrey C. Ollie 2025-07-06 16:48:15 -05:00
  • 103772ee8f show child exited: make GTK banner transparent Jeffrey C. Ollie 2025-07-06 16:30:53 -05:00
  • cd9174e7e8 show child exited: fix macos build Jeffrey C. Ollie 2025-07-06 16:17:37 -05:00
  • 033d8c3099 core/gtk: add apprt action to show native GUI warning when child exits Jeffrey C. Ollie 2025-07-06 15:06:00 -05:00
  • 1e88984709 Merge branch 'main' into fix-copy-url Alex 2025-07-11 20:21:05 -07:00
  • 1cafd45828 Decouple icon width from adjust-cell-{height,width} Daniel Wennberg 2025-07-11 11:54:37 -07:00
  • 391290aa4a i18n: Update Korean Translations (#7885) trag1c 2025-07-11 21:29:52 +02:00
  • 1ed28d62e6 Update last revision date Merijntje Tak 2025-07-11 20:24:41 +02:00
  • f91fb5645b Updated translation of "Command Palette", see discussion in PR. Merijntje Tak 2025-07-11 19:40:04 +02:00
  • c4e10a1ac1 Update po/ko_KR.UTF-8.po Hojin You 2025-07-11 10:06:34 -04:00
  • 6c0adaed0f renderer: Allow the renderer to draw transparent cells (#7913) Mitchell Hashimoto 2025-07-11 07:01:54 -07:00
  • 991426e84e renderer: Allow the renderer to draw transparent cells nferhat 2025-07-11 12:47:28 +01:00
  • f8c9597a3a Minor change: updated url of sentry sdk Marco Zanon 2025-07-11 12:00:52 +02:00
  • 9599ba5f9e Add type to Item tagged union to enable decoding of session object Marco Zanon 2025-07-11 12:00:24 +02:00
  • dfca0c8752 Session decode function Marco Zanon 2025-07-11 11:57:09 +02:00
  • cefd34e03e Session class Marco Zanon 2025-07-11 11:56:29 +02:00
  • 4aa28988a6 build: zig build test runs Xcode tests on macOS (#7909) Mitchell Hashimoto 2025-07-10 21:21:46 -07:00
  • 2dce107738 ci: downgrade back to Xcode 26 beta 1, the icon is broken in beta 3 (#7911) Mitchell Hashimoto 2025-07-10 21:15:37 -07:00
  • cb3f67e810 build(deps): bump namespacelabs/nscloud-cache-action from 1.2.8 to 1.2.9 (#7910) Mitchell Hashimoto 2025-07-10 21:12:38 -07:00
  • cfad2e817b ci: downgrade back to Xcode 26 beta 1, the icon is broken in beta 3 Mitchell Hashimoto 2025-07-10 21:11:55 -07:00
  • 9fa26387ef build: zig build test runs Xcode tests on macOS Mitchell Hashimoto 2025-07-10 07:10:50 -07:00
  • 099a2d7f03 build(deps): bump namespacelabs/nscloud-cache-action from 1.2.8 to 1.2.9 dependabot[bot] 2025-07-11 00:13:59 +00:00
  • c03942d3c1 bash: preserve an existing ENV value (#7908) Jon Parise 2025-07-10 19:06:31 -04:00
  • c25e10492a scroll: round up fractional mouse scroll ticks John Drouhard 2025-04-24 14:00:23 -05:00
  • 9a3a6a8352 ci: add shellcheck linting for shell scripts (#7904) Mitchell Hashimoto 2025-07-10 14:42:13 -07:00
  • 01233a48d1 bash: preserve an existing ENV value Jon Parise 2025-07-10 15:12:54 -04:00
  • cbb3f6f64f ci: add shellcheck linting for shell scripts Bryan Lee 2025-07-10 23:16:23 +08:00
  • 4dc4911ece Update po/ko_KR.UTF-8.po Hojin You 2025-07-10 14:46:46 -04:00
  • 3d0e29f3ff Reverted change, updated ellipsis for unicode char Merijntje Tak 2025-07-10 19:53:57 +02:00
  • cc646ecf46 Fix custom shader cursor uniforms not set for non-block cursors (#7897) Qwerasd 2025-07-10 09:26:46 -06:00
  • 1172332621 ci: update sequoia builders to xcode 26 beta 3, output version in CI (#7901) Mitchell Hashimoto 2025-07-10 07:27:17 -07:00
  • c23e3f8586 ci: update sequoia builders to xcode 26 beta 3, output version in CI Mitchell Hashimoto 2025-07-10 07:06:53 -07:00
  • 530785926e elvish: revise the ssh integration (#7894) Jon Parise 2025-07-10 07:58:37 -04:00
  • 36a3a3ffa4 Add tests for getCursorGlyph() helper function ClearAspect 2025-07-10 01:48:44 -04:00
  • 1de35bbcb9 Fix viewport going out of bounds when zooming out (#7899) Qwerasd 2025-07-09 23:15:26 -06:00
  • ea4a056d34 test(terminal/PageList): resize keeps viewport <= active Qwerasd 2025-07-09 22:47:01 -06:00
  • 68418ecd53 Modernize our benchmarks (#7891) Mitchell Hashimoto 2025-07-09 21:42:53 -07:00
  • cc23d3259a Merge b29c759e8bda134b308dddb17c15d2734a388c2b into 1317a55a9dcc1cebdef1429f0805b8c949b24c32 Jacob Sandlund 2025-07-10 14:41:13 +10:00
  • 1317a55a9d build: make the xcframework step dsym aware, even though we don't use it (#7898) Mitchell Hashimoto 2025-07-09 21:41:10 -07:00
  • cc0d7acaef build: make the xcframework step dsym aware, even though we don't use it Mitchell Hashimoto 2025-07-09 21:05:54 -07:00
  • 6744e57c68 fix(terminal/PageList): update viewport in row count resize Qwerasd 2025-07-09 22:27:50 -06:00
  • 88736a2ddb Fix custom shader cursor uniforms not set for non-block cursors (#7893) ClearAspect 2025-07-10 00:08:37 -04:00
  • 5cdfe3d70e elvish: revise the ssh integration Jon Parise 2025-07-09 21:44:32 -04:00
  • d0c5191aef build(deps): bump cachix/install-nix-action from 31.4.1 to 31.5.0 (#7892) Mitchell Hashimoto 2025-07-09 18:23:05 -07:00
  • e962e9b517 build(deps): bump cachix/install-nix-action from 31.4.1 to 31.5.0 dependabot[bot] 2025-07-10 00:22:27 +00:00
  • b29c759e8b Merge branch 'main' into jacob/zg Jacob Sandlund 2025-07-09 19:18:19 -04:00
  • 74b94ef30a remove src/bench Mitchell Hashimoto 2025-07-09 15:02:07 -07:00
  • a09452bf1b synthetic: add osc/utf8 generators Mitchell Hashimoto 2025-07-09 15:00:48 -07:00
  • a28b7e9205 synthetic cli (ghostty-gen) Mitchell Hashimoto 2025-07-09 14:42:19 -07:00
  • b5ff0442d4 bench: remove old benchmarks we converted Mitchell Hashimoto 2025-07-09 14:32:34 -07:00
  • 99ed984af2 benchmark: add GraphemeBreak and TerminalParser benchmarks Mitchell Hashimoto 2025-07-09 14:31:47 -07:00
  • 5890826356 benchmark: add codepoint width benchmark Mitchell Hashimoto 2025-07-09 14:23:59 -07:00
  • c990d35d6d macos: add benchmark tests to our Xcode project Mitchell Hashimoto 2025-07-09 13:22:04 -07:00
  • 20bb71c627 libghostty: export benchmark CLI API Mitchell Hashimoto 2025-07-09 11:33:00 -07:00
  • 01b2545d1d macos: fix signpost API to use proper mach header base addr Mitchell Hashimoto 2025-07-08 16:24:36 -07:00